Comprehending the Finnish Driver's License System

In Finland, a chauffeur's license should adhere to EU policies, ensuring consistency and security requirements throughout member states. The Finnish system classifies licenses based on the kind of lorry one wants to drive, including:

ridicak.webp
License CategoriesAutomobile Type
AMMopeds and light motorcycles
AHeavy bikes
BCars (as much as 3,500 kg)
CTrucks (over 3,500 kg)
DBuses and passenger lorries
ETrailers

Actions to Apply for a Driver's License in Finland

  1. Fulfill the Age Requirement

    • For a category B license (cars and truck), the minimum age is 18 years. More youthful candidates can get AM and A licenses at 15 and 24 respectively.
  2. Obtain a Learner's Permit

    • Before getting a full driver's license, people need to get a student's permit, allowing them to practice driving under particular conditions.
  3. Complete the Required Theory and Practical Training

    • Candidates should go through theoretical training that covers road guidelines, safety protocols, and lorry handling, generally through an approved driving school.
  4. Pass the Theory Exam

    • At the end of the training, prospects must pass a theoretical exam that checks their understanding regarding roadway rules and safe driving practices.
  5. Acquire Practical Road Training

    • Prospects are needed to finish a minimum variety of training hours behind the wheel, under the supervision of a licensed trainer.
  6. Pass the Driving Test

    • After effectively completing the useful training and theory exam, candidates can schedule a driving test, where they should show their driving abilities.
  7. Obtain Medical Clearance

    • A medical exam is frequently needed to examine fitness to drive, especially for those making an application for business lorry licenses (C, D).

Application Costs

The costs for getting a motorist's license in Finland can differ quite substantially based on the classification and the driving school chosen. Here is the approximated breakdown of various expenditures:

Expense CategoryEstimated Cost (EUR)
Learner's Permit Fee50
Driving School Tuition1,200 - 2,000
Theory Exam Fee20
Practical Test Fee60 - 100
Medical Exam Fee30 - 150
Overall Estimated Cost1,390 - 2,350

These costs can vary depending on place, extra lessons required, and private circumstances.

Application Process

When prospects have completed their training and tests, they can submit their application to the regional authorities workplace or traffic authority. The needed documents typically consist of:

brno-ridicsky-prukaz-vymena-ara_denik-63
  • Completed application kind
  • A current passport-sized photo
  • Proof of identity (national ID or passport)
  • Medical certificate (if appropriate)
  • Payment receipt for appropriate fees
